/* GLOBAL STYLING */

body { 

	margin:0; padding:0;
	
	background:#000;
	
	font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; color:#fff; line-height:22px; text-align:left;
}

a:link, a:visited, a:active, a:hover { color:#000; text-decoration:none; border:0; }

#wrapper {
	
	margin:0 auto; padding:0;
	
	width:906px; overflow:hidden;
}

#container { 
	
	margin:60px auto 30px auto; padding:0; position:relative;
	
	width:906px; color:#000;
	
	background: #fff url(../images/blog-header-bg.gif) top left no-repeat; overflow:hidden;
}

/* BANNER */

#banner3 {
	
	width:694px; height:55px; float:right; position:relative;
	
	margin:0; padding:0 0 0 0; left:0px; top: 35px; z-index:999;
	
	background: url(../images/banner3.jpg) top left no-repeat; 
}

#banner p {
	
	font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; color:#fff; line-height:18px; text-align:left;
	
	padding:7px 0 7px 152px; margin:0;
}

#banner p span { color:#bcd736; }


/* BLOG CONTENT */

#header {
	
	width:906px; height:69px;
	
	margin:0; padding:0;
}

a.header-link { width:165px; height:69px; margin:0; padding:0; display:block; float:left; border:0;}
a.header-link span {display:none;}

#header ul { list-style:none; width:690px; float:right; }
#header ul li {
	
	list-style:none; float: left;
	
	margin:40px 0 0 0; padding:0 0 0 20px;
	
	font-family: Arial, Helvetica, sans-serif; font-size:14px; font-weight:bold; color:#cccccc;
}

#header ul li a {color:#cccccc; text-decoration:none;}
#header ul li a:hover {color:#c5e130; text-decoration:none;}
#header ul li a.active {color:#c5e130; text-decoration:none;}
#header ul li a.active:hover {color:#c5e130; text-decoration:none;}

#column-one {
	
	margin:0; padding:0;
	
	width:331px;
	
	float:left;
}


#column-one p { margin:0; padding: 5px 35px;}
#column-one span { color:#666;}

h1 {
	
	padding:0; margin:40px 35px 10px;
	
	color:#bcd736; font-size:18px; font-family:Arial, Helvetica, sans-serif; font-weight:normal;
}

h1 span { display:none; }

h1.nail-views { background:url(../images/h1-nail-views.gif) top left no-repeat; height:25px; width:116px; }
h1.insider-videos { background:url(../images/h1-insider-videos.gif) top left no-repeat; height:25px; width:200px; }
h1.whats-happening { background:url(../images/h1-whats-happening.gif) top left no-repeat; height:25px; width:200px; }

#column-one ul { list-style:none; color:#000; margin:10px 0 0 0; }
#column-one ul li {
	
	margin:0; padding:0 0 0 35px;
	
	list-style:none;
}

#column-one ul li a { font-size:11px; text-decoration: underline; }
#column-one ul li a:hover { font-size:11px; text-decoration: none;}

#column-one ul li a.black { font-size:11px; text-decoration: underline; color:#000;}
#column-one ul li a.black:hover { font-size:11px; text-decoration: none; color:#000;}

#column-one ul li a.video-link { font-size:11px; text-decoration: underline; color:#000; }
#column-one ul li a.video-link:hover { font-size:11px; text-decoration: none; color:#000;}

#column-one ul li a.mora:hover { font-size:11px; text-decoration: underline; color:#80a709;}
#column-one ul li a.mora:hover { font-size:11px; text-decoration: none; color:#80a709;}


#column-two {
	
	width:575px; float:left;
	
	margin:0; padding:0;
}

#column-two p { margin:0; padding: 5px 25px;}

h2 {
	
	padding:0; margin:40px 25px 10px;
	
	color:#bcd736; font-size:18px; font-family:Arial, Helvetica, sans-serif; font-weight:normal;
}
h2 img {float:right;}
h2 span { display:none; }

h2.fashion-prep { background:url(../images/blog-main-title.jpg) top left no-repeat; height:25px; width:525px; }

#column-two p a {color:#80a709; text-decoration:underline;}
#column-two p a:hover {color:#80a709; text-decoration:none;}

div.post {padding-bottom:20px;}

/* FOOTER */

#footer {
	
	width:906px; height:53px; clear:both;
	
	margin:0; padding:0;
	
	background: url(../images/blog-footer.gif) top left no-repeat;
}




